| In 1965, UNO students voted and chose the school's colors of silver and blue and chose the name "Privateers." |
![]() |
| In 1984 UNO adopted Lafitte, the silver and blue alligator dressed as a Privateer for its mascot. Lafitte appears at games with the cheerleaders and dance team and attends other UNO functions as well. |
